Hi all

I'm 6 weeks into an out door grow and am wanting to main line my plant.
My issue is at the beginning of my grow I had very cloudy days for two weeks which caused my plants to stretch a lot. There would be about 11 inches from the top of the soil to the 3rd node where I want to begin the manifold.

my questions are;

would this distance be an issue when beginning to main line and if so would it be too late to burry the stem deeper into the soil when I re put next?
 
being an indoor guy take this with a grain of salt.would bury a couple inches deeper then mound up soil on stalk like a top dressing. the 11 inches sounds like a lot but if it physically do'able without hurting a woody plant you should be ok. i answer only cuzz no else has. so come on ppl straighten us both out here.
